WE SHOULD BE ABLE TO MOVE DIVISIONS.
All the soccerproject staff are concerned about fairness of the game, and yet, I found out that my route way up is harder than most other ways. F223 has a very high rating, even as high as some E-divisions. So, I have thought about this, and thought we should be able to move as long as:

:arrow: Its at the end of season so people do not cheat,
:arrow: We pay a fee, for example, 3 million euros to avoid everyone moving around,
:arrow: we will be moving to the same level divisions. For example, if you are in F, you cannot move from F to E, but can move to any other divisions in F,
:arrow: There is a gap in the division (an FC Team / computer team).

Have I missed any important points out?
If so, please add your comments.
I will run a poll to see other people's opinions.

Sjarel, Mr SoccerProject developer, please think about this. I think evening same level divisions out will encourage people to play for longer.
